gpt4 book ai didi

javascript - Uglify.JS 缩小文件名而不是文件内容

转载 作者:行者123 更新时间:2023-12-03 01:47:24 24 4
gpt4 key购买 nike

我正在使用 uglifyjs 来缩小 js 文件,但是当我运行该工具时,它会缩小我传递的文件名而不是内容。

var resultugly = UglifyJS.minify(['app_client/app.js']);
console.log(resultugly.code);

日志结果为:app_client,app.js;不是文件内容

有人可以帮我吗?

最佳答案

我解决了这个问题,发生的情况是我需要在导入文件之前使用“fs”模块中的 readFileSync 函数,例如:

var appClientFiles = [
fs.readFileSync('app_client/app.js', "utf8")
];

然后只需将向量与或文件作为 uglify minify 函数的参数传递,如下所示:

var resultugly = UglifyJS.minify(appClientFiles);

我希望能帮助别人

关于javascript - Uglify.JS 缩小文件名而不是文件内容,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50576097/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com